Mini Meatball Subs

Tasty mini meatball subs - made in under 30 minutes!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ings 4
Author Leslie Means

Ingredients

  • 1 pound Ground Chuck Or Ground Beef
  • 1/2 cup Panko Or Other Bread Crumbs I used crushed crackers
  • 1 clove Garlic Min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on Salt
  • Freshly Ground Black Pepper
  • 1/2 cup Milk
  • 2 Tablespoons Olive Oil
  • 1/2 whole Medium Onion Diced
  • 1 jar large Marinara Sauce
  • 12 whole Dinner Rolls or Slider Rolls
  • 4 slices Provolone Cheese Cut Into Four Wedges Each, or shredded cheese

Instructions

  • Mix meat with bread crumbs, garlic, salt, pepper, and milk. Knead together with hands. Roll into heaping tablespoon-sized rolls.
  •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add onions and cook for one minute. Add meatballs between the onions and brown for one minute. (You might have to do this in two batches, depending on the size of your skillet.)
  • Pour in jar of marinara; shake pan gently to mix. Put on lid and allow to simmer for 20 minutes.
  • When ready to serve, cut each dinner roll in half. Place a wedge of Provolone on the top and bottom of each roll. Spoon a meatball with the sauce onto the bottom bun; top with the top bun.
  • Serve immediately!
